如何解决RDS MySQL 一旦过程出现错误,即使使用有效值,它也会重复直到启动新会话
我终于注意到我们在处理数据时收到的间歇性错误。当我们执行存储过程并报告“A 列不能为空”时,错误显示,但是当我们跟踪记录并手动运行该过程时,它工作正常。我可以使用以下内容重复此错误。
- 使用有效值运行程序,它成功
- 使用无效值运行相同的过程,失败并显示“A 列不能为空”
- 使用步骤 1 中相同的有效值重新运行相同的过程,但失败并出现相同的错误
- 打开一个新选项卡/会话并重新运行与第 1 步相同的过程,现在再次成功。
我真的在摸索这个问题,似乎找不到正确的文档来提供帮助。我们在 AWS RDS 上使用 MysqL 5.7。似乎会话正在兑现错误,并且无论何时调用该过程,它都会简单地从现金中提取错误。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。